Best-selling books in St. Louis for the week ending September 11

Subterranean Books
Subterranean Books

Below is the top-ten list of the St. Louis region's best-selling adult and children's books. The list is compiled by the St. Louis Independent Bookstore Alliance.

For the week ending September 11:

Adult:

  1. Time to Plant: Southern-Style Garden Living by James T. Farmer
  2. The Help by Kathryn Stockett
  3. Bossypants by Tina Fey
  4. The Heart and The Fist by Eric Greitens
  5. Noir at the Bar edited by Jedediah Ayers and Scott Phillips
  6. Unlikely Friendships by Jennifer Holland
  7. The Leftovers by Tom Perotta
  8. The Magician King by Lev Grossman
  9. Go The F* To Sleep by Adam Mansbach
  10. Their Eyes Were Watching God by Zora Neale Hurston

 
Children/Young Adult:

  1. Skippyjon Jones, Class Action by Judy Schachner
  2. Miss Peregrine's Home for Peculiar Children by Ransom Riggs
  3. The Hunger Games by Suzanne Collins
  4. Runaway Twin by Peg Kehret
  5. Feed by M.T. Anderson
  6. Skippyjon Jones by Judy Schachner
  7. Wildwood: The Wildwood Chronicles Book One by Colin Meloy
  8. Green Eggs and Ham by Dr. Seuss
  9. The Bridge to Never Land by Dave Barry and Ridley Pearson
  10. The Wizard of Oz Scanimation by Rufus Butler Seder
